Pork is the meat from a Pig; it’s produced when a pasture becomes full and the excess Pigs are slaughtered. Pork is a protein food and can also be used to make other products:

The Pig Butcher uses Pork to make Pork Cuts, Bacon and Tallow.





<p style="margin-top:0in;margin-right:0in;margin-bottom:.0001pt;margin-left:.5in;">
The Meat Tinnery can use Pork to make Tinned Meat.





<p style="margin-top:0in;margin-right:0in;margin-bottom:.0001pt;margin-left:.5in;">
The Pub Kitchen can make Pub Meals using Pork + Salt.
